To keep the Metro Glide 300 in top condition, perform the following maintenance routines:
- Tire Pressure: Check the air-filled tires regularly. Maintain the recommended PSI (found on the tire sidewall) to prevent flats and ensure a smooth glide.
- Bolt Checks: Periodically inspect all screws and axle bolts, ensuring they remain tight, especially after the first few rides.
- Cleaning: Wipe the frame with a soft, damp cloth. Avoid using harsh chemicals or pressure washers to prevent damage to the finish.
- Storage: Since the unit does not fold, identify a dedicated storage spot in a garage or shed where it can remain upright using its integrated kickstand.
